What to Keep in Mind Before You Start Creating
While Digital Paper Christmas is designed for ease of use, a few practical considerations help maximize results:
- No editable layers or vectors: These are flattened JPG filesâideal for immediate printing and digital use, but not suited for deep customization (e.g., changing individual element colors). If you need full editability, pair this set with vector-based holiday elements separately.
- CMYK-first workflow: Always open and export final designs in CMYK if sending to a professional printer. While RGB works fine for web and screen use, CMYK prevents unexpected color shifts during physical production.
- Scale wisely: Though 3600Ă3600 pixels supports large prints, avoid stretching beyond 12Ă12 inches unless youâre using software that supports intelligent upscaling (e.g., Adobe Photoshopâs Preserve Details 2.0). For oversized banners or wall decals, consider repeating the pattern rather than enlarging it.
